Buenos Aires

Buenos Aires is made up of a lively city center with little suburbs scattered around it. Staying in the city center is the best option when in Buenos Aires, you can easily travel to and from the multiple regions as transport fees are cheap.

“A walking tour is a must-do, you will get a real feel for the city where you can see more than if you were doing a bus tour. Buenos Aires center reminds me of Paris, with its colonial buildings, open parks and dainty cafes.”

“A visit to Le Recoleta Cemetery is a wonderful place to visit, there were memorials and tombs that were out of this world. The statues and tombs were designed with intricate detailing’s, which was a very impressive sight to see.”

South America Tours - Buenos Aires Cemetary - Luxury south America holidays

“If you want to fit in with the locals, a trip to the Sunday Rag market will have you purchasing anything from retro telephones, signs and used bits and bobs.”

“I really enjoyed the Tango show Buenos Aires, it was very entertaining and fun to watch, I would really recommend this to couples and honeymooners. It’s a great way to begin your evening, watching the talented dancers perform while enjoying and exquisite dinner.”

South America Tours - Buenos Aires michelle Selfie - Luxury south America holidays

There are many neighborhoods in Buenos Aires. If you’re looking for upmarket shops and boutiques you may want to visit Palermo, which is only 20 minutes from the city center. For gourmet restaurants, spend an afternoon in Recoleta, which also showcases a range of galleries and cafes. For an interesting sightseeing tour visit Caminito, a small residential suburb. This place takes you to a whole new ambient, expect vibrant retro buildings with Italian and Argentinian influences, a distant contrast of the colonial center of Buenos Aires.

Iguazu Falls National Park

“If there’s one place to get the ultimate WOW factor, it has to be at the spectacular Iguazu National Park.”

michelle embarks on the best south africa tours - Iguazu Falls National Park

There are 4 different ways to see the Iguazu Falls, from the Argentina side, the Brazilian side, by boat or helicopter. The falls are in Argentina but in the border, so can be seen on the Brazilian Side. All together there are an outstanding 275 individual waterfalls. As well as the waterfalls, you can spend some time spotting the natural habitats within the park from exotic butterflies, lizards and Jaguars.”

“All views of the falls were absolutely mesmerizing and majestic, but personally I preferred the Argentina side, as you really get to see the scale of the falls.”

“We took a speedboat to get up close to the falls, which was really amazing. Another great way to see the falls is via the boardwalk.”

Rio

“The stigma behind Rio is that it is unsafe and homes the poor, throughout my time in Rio, I never felt unsafe and thought that the area was very clean and friendly.”

michelle embarks on the best south africa tours - Rio

“You can expect plenty of beach, Ocean and mountains in Rio, as well as many shanti towns to explore. Copoacabana beach is family-friendly and offers plenty of sports, from beach volleyball to watersports. There is even a separate running and cyclist track besides the main road and gym apparatus hot points.

michelle embarks on the best south africa tours - selfie

“Sugarloaf Mountain and Christ Redeemer are two fabulous must-dos! To reach Sugarloaf Mountain take a cable car, which has an interval stop. You’ll see monkeys on the highest peak. To get to Christ Redeemer you will need to take the metro, the seats are angled so you get the best possible views, it is recommend to book tickets in advance to avoid disappointment.”
